本文目錄導(dǎo)讀:
CSS到底怎么玩?
CSS,全稱層疊樣式表(Cascading Style Sheets),是一種用來描述HTML文檔樣式的計(jì)算機(jī)語言,它可以控制網(wǎng)頁的排版、顏色、字體等,讓網(wǎng)頁更加美觀、易用,CSS到底怎么玩呢?
基礎(chǔ)語法
CSS的基礎(chǔ)語法包括選擇器、屬性和值,選擇器用于選擇需要樣式的HTML元素,屬性用于指定樣式屬性,值則用于給出屬性的具體樣式,以下代碼可以將所有段落文本的顏色設(shè)置為藍(lán)色:
p { color: blue; }
選擇器類型
CSS中有很多選擇器類型,包括元素選擇器、類選擇器、ID選擇器、屬性選擇器等,元素選擇器用于選擇所有指定的HTML元素,類選擇器用于選擇具有指定類的元素,ID選擇器用于選擇具有指定ID的元素,屬性選擇器則用于選擇具有指定屬性的元素。
樣式屬性
CSS中有很多樣式屬性,包括顏色、字體、背景、邊框等,這些屬性可以用來控制網(wǎng)頁的外觀和排版,以下代碼可以將所有段落文本的字體設(shè)置為宋體:
p { font-family: SongTi; }
層疊與繼承
CSS中的層疊與繼承是其重要的特性之一,層疊指的是不同樣式的優(yōu)先級,而繼承則指的是子元素可以繼承父元素的樣式,這些特性使得CSS的樣式更加靈活和可維護(hù)。
預(yù)處理器和框架
除了基礎(chǔ)的CSS語法外,還有很多預(yù)處理器和框架可以幫助我們更加高效地編寫CSS代碼,Sass、Less等預(yù)處理器可以將CSS代碼轉(zhuǎn)化為更加易于維護(hù)和擴(kuò)展的格式,而Bootstrap等框架則提供了一系列常用的CSS組件和樣式。
CSS是一種強(qiáng)大而靈活的計(jì)算機(jī)語言,可以用來控制網(wǎng)頁的外觀和排版,通過學(xué)習(xí)和實(shí)踐,我們可以掌握CSS的基礎(chǔ)語法和特性,并創(chuàng)造出更加美觀、易用的網(wǎng)頁。